-
Публикаций
5 630 -
Баллов
14 098 -
Зарегистрирован
-
Посещение
-
Победитель дней
15
Тип контента
Профили
Форумы
Пользовательские тракты
Галерея
Колекции
Блоги
Объявления
Магазин
Articles
Весь контент IgorA
-
Так и задумано.
-
Смотрел долго под Win7 и 32- и 64-бита - нет утечки памяти при обновлениях веб-интерфейса. В пределах десятков килобайт занятая память флуктуирует, но в среднем остаётся на одном уровне.
-
Это авторский произвольный выбор в отношении внутренних идентификаторов, используемых в проекте. Завидую людям с избытком свободного времени.
-
Надо посмотреть - совпадает ли третья секция IP адреса роутера и Yoctoap. Если нет, исправить адрес в apconfig.txt.
-
Для временной заплатки надо продублировать aplayer. ini на один уровень выше папки плеера.
-
Там не загружаются настройки из aplayer.ini из-за ошибки в путях и используются настройки по умолчанию. Поправлю.
-
Я не думаю, что интенсивно работающий один поток планировщик будет гонять по разным ядрам. Тем более, что можно посмотреть потоки процесса и потребляемые ими ресурсы в Process Explorer, там будут видны ID потоков.
-
Речь идёт о том, что надо запустить конфигуратор ap2config_x64.exe и там выбрать эти опции на первой вкладке настроек. Но они обычно выбраны и так, по умолчанию. Как модуль вывода там же надо выбрать EXTRAS ASIO. Тогда при выходе из ap2config запустится конфигуратор модуля вывода EXTRAS ASIO asio_x64_config.exe. Там надо выбрать устройство вывода и включить опцию Hold ASIO Output.
-
В русском интерфейсе он называется “Стандартный”.
-
От щелчков при естественном переходе между треками избавляет включение режима вывода Standard и опции Gapless Mode на первой вкладке apconfig. Щелчки при ручном переключении могут в разной мере проявляться при использовании разных модулей вывода. Если использовать EXTRAS ASIO, там может помочь включение опции Hold ASIO Output в панели настроек модуля вывода.
-
Мне всё и так нравится.
-
По числу каналов: 2-6. В какой-то ещё дифференциации, помимо существующей трёхступенчатой (1 ядро / 2 ядра / все ядра), смысла не вижу.
-
Декодер DSD многопоточный.
-
Здесь обычный рецепт - режим вывода Standard, включенная опция Gapless Mode.
-
Если воспроизведение работает стабильно, то оставить как есть.
-
Здесь критичен размер буфера драйвера и приоритет доступа к нему. В разных плеерах могут быть разные настройки по умолчанию. Какой модуль вывода и режим вывода используется? Если Extras ASIO, можно попробовать вместо него Standard и там выбрать в контекстном меню режим вывода out_asio.dll. Если WASAPI, переключить режим PUSH на PULL. Если KS, увеличить размер буфера в конфигураторе KS. Ещё можно во всех вариантах попробовать включить в apconfig опцию Одно Ядро, период таймера 1 мс, realtime приоритет.
-
Декодер FLAC от разработчиков формата останавливается, обнаружив дефект в файле. Другие декодеры пропускают ошибки, ограничиваясь артефактами в воспроизведении. Можно получить этот эффект, добавив расширение FLAC в список расширений FFmpeg декодера ("Форматы файлов" в контекстном меню, там строка, которая начинается с "RAD"). Тогда не будут использоваться картинки и .cue, вшитые внутрь FLAC файлов, но, может быть, это не критично.
-
Чтобы в статике всё собралось в один файл, надо компилировать библиотеки ffmpeg из пропатченных для XP исходников в Visual Studio 2015. Это отдельная морока, да и исходников таких у меня нет.
-
Вот вариант in_ffmpeg.dll для XP, который будет открывать ссылки на радио из m3u: https://disk.yandex.ru/d/vrYJ7jxuXBVANQ Там убрана только поддержка ссылок из m3u на другие m3u.
-
На XP .m3u и .pls с радио не будут работать. Там нужна статическая компоновка с библиотеками ffmpeg, а для XP есть только динамическая.
-
Я проверил на радио в TinyAP с телефона через хром громкость нормально регулируется во всех трёх веб-интерфейсах. То есть, тут какая-то локальная проблема. Возможно, аппаратная регулировка громкости некорректно работает, тогда надо снять опцию HW, оставить программную. И когда выводится звук в DSD без преобразования в PCM, то регулировка громкости программная вообще не поддерживается и HW тоже может не поддерживаться.
-
У меня играют обе станции из примера. Radio.m3u лежит в папке Radio. Надо не только в папку Radio файл положить, но и включить режим радио в веб-интерфейсе. Там для этого в левом верхнем углу есть специальная кнопка.
-
Поддержка pls и m3u с внешними ссылками добавлена только для радиокаталога, как и сказано в описании обновления. А он отображается при включении режима радио в интерфейсе. И там работает этот пример. Для правильного отображения заголовков надо добавить "-1," (без кавычек) перед 011.FM.
-
И так будет, я отвечал о том, что можно сделать на стороне системы.
